Grand Falls Closed To Tourists Until Further Notice

by on March 7, 2023 0

Residents from the Adah’iilíní (Grand Falls) and Leupp community have decided to temporarily close Adah’iilíní (Grand Falls) to the public until further notice, citing the need to steward the land and protect the sacred site. TSA Is Prepared For Higher Passenger Volumes For Spring Break Travel Season

by on February 23, 2023 0

The Transportation Security Administration (TSA) is prepared for spring break travelers and offers a few travel tips for the most efficient checkpoint experience. The spring break travel season begins around Feb. 17 and continues through April 21.
